Ratio and Proportion:

1. The sum of the 3 numbers is 148. If the ratio of the first to the second is 1:3 and that of the second to the third is 4:7, then the first number is:

Solution:
               Let the numbers be x, y and z.
               x:y = 1:3 and y:z = 4:7
               x:y:z = 4:12:21

               4a+12a+21a = 148.
               37a =148
               a = 4.
               The first number is 4a = 16.

2. A fraction which bears the same ratio to 3/7 that 1/9 does to 5/12, is equal to:

Solution:
               Let that fraction be x.
               x:3/7 :: 1/9: 5/12
               (3/7)*(1/9) = x*(5/12)
               x = 4/35.
